Wow! He missed 2 of the Fab Five: Jalen Rose and Jimmy King! (Timeout we never did get Chris Webber on the Raptors yeah? Or Juwan Howard. Ray Jackson the last of the Five was never drafted to the NBA (ouch!) so that means Toronto scored half of them.)

When the Raptors first started the NBA were terrible…I mean Master P was in the league.

There were a lot of baaaaad players as his list confirms. This is less about the evolution of the Raptors history and more about how the NBA has flourished.

Now with international development; all kinds of leagues and opportunities the bulk of the NBA’s players are really strong and really good. Teams still struggle because fit isn’t right; tanking though lessened is still an attractive option (trust the process, come on really?).

However, happily, this means competition is increasing; it’s getting harder which is amazing and inspiring. Every game should be an epic battle; a struggle and a conquest. Especially as we get into the NBA Playoffs.
